What affects the price of Cialis vs tadalafil?
Common drivers of price differences include:
- Brand vs generic: Generic tadalafil is usually cheaper than brand Cialis.
- Dosage and quantity: Higher mg strength and larger pack counts tend to cost more.
- Daily vs as-needed regimens: “Daily” dosing (often 2.5–5 mg depending on the product/country) may cost differently than occasional use (often 10–20 mg as needed).
- Pharmacy and pricing programs: Some pharmacies discount tadalafil through in-store programs or online pricing.
- Insurance coverage: Coverage can substantially change your out-of-pocket cost, especially for brand products.
Is there a cheaper alternative to buying Cialis at full price?
If your goal is to reduce out-of-pocket costs, the main levers are:
- Switch to generic tadalafil if appropriate.
- Use pharmacy price comparisons (in-store or online) because pricing can vary widely.
- Check manufacturer or pharmacy discount programs where available.
- Ask your clinician whether a lower dose schedule could meet your needs.
